How To Install perl-Class-ReturnValue on CentOS 7

In this tutorial we learn how to install perl-Class-ReturnValue on CentOS 7. perl-Class-ReturnValue is Class::ReturnValue Perl module

What is perl-Class-ReturnValue

A return-value object that lets you treat it as as a boolean, array or object.

We can use yum or dnf to install perl-Class-ReturnValue on CentOS 7. In this tutorial we discuss both methods but you only need to choose one of method to install perl-Class-ReturnValue.

Install perl-Class-ReturnValue on CentOS 7 Using yum

Update yum database with yum using the following command.

sudo yum makecache

After updating yum database, We can install perl-Class-ReturnValue using yum by running the following command:

sudo yum -y install perl-Class-ReturnValue

Install perl-Class-ReturnValue on CentOS 7 Using dnf

If you don’t have dnf installed you can install DNF on CentOS 7 first. Update yum database with dnf using the following command.

sudo dnf makecache

After updating yum database, We can install perl-Class-ReturnValue using dnf by running the following command:

sudo dnf -y install perl-Class-ReturnValue

How To Uninstall perl-Class-ReturnValue on CentOS 7

To uninstall only the perl-Class-ReturnValue package we can use the following command:

sudo dnf remove perl-Class-ReturnValue
